Dlaczego ludzie odnoszą sukces? Bo są mądrzy? A może mają szczęście? Ani jedno, ani drugie. Analityk Richard St. John skondensował lata rozmów w trzyminutowym wystąpieniu o prawdziwym sekrecie sukcesu.

A self-described average guy who found success doing what he loved, Richard St. John spent more than a decade researching the lessons of success -- and distilling them into 8 words, 3 minutes and one successful book. Full bio »
